Is British Bangladeshi a nationality?

British Bangladeshis (Bengali: ?????? ?????????, Sylheti: ?????? ?????????) are people of Bangladeshi origin who have attained citizenship in the United Kingdom, through immigration and historical naturalisation. This large diaspora in London leads people in Sylhet to refer to British Bangladeshis as "Londonis".

Keeping this in consideration, can I have a British and Bangladeshi passport?

Bangladesh permits dual citizenship under limited circumstances. Citizens of USA, UK Australia, Canada and Europe of Bangladeshi origin may apply for a Dual Nationality Certificate. This certificate makes it legal to possess a Bangladeshi passport in addition to a foreign passport.

How many nationalities are in the UK?

In 2016, there were 3.6 million people resident in the UK who were born abroad and held British nationality (39% of the non-UK born population – compared with 40% the previous year). Of the 3.5 million residents in 2016 that were born within the EU (not including UK born): 525,000 (15%) held British nationality.

Is Bangladesh allow dual citizenship?

Bangladeshi citizenship is based primarily on jus sanguinis, through blood. Bangladesh permits dual citizenship under limited circumstances. Citizens of USA, UK Australia, Canada and Europe of Bangladeshi origin may apply for a Dual Nationality Certificate.

Do British citizens need a visa for Bangladesh?

Visas. You'll need a visa to enter Bangladesh. Although British Nationals are eligible for Visa on arrival for a period of 1 month for the purpose of official duty, business, investment and tourism, we recommend obtaining a visa before travelling.

Can I visit Bangladesh without passport?

Passports must be valid for six months beyond your planned stay in Bangladesh, have at least one blank page, and have a Bangladeshi visa. You must possess an onward or return ticket. We strongly recommend obtaining a visa before traveling. Visas must be in a valid passport.

What is the main religion in Bangladesh?

The Constitution of Bangladesh declares Islam as the state religion. Bangladesh is the fourth-largest Muslim-populated country. Muslims are the predominant community of the country and they form the majority of the population in all eight divisions of Bangladesh.

Is Bangladesh a 3rd world country?

Bangladesh is considered to be a third world country and the etymology of the term 'third world' is quite interesting. It was coined by a French economist and demographer named Alfred Sauvy,who considered these developing countries in South Asia, Latin America and Africa to be like the Third Estate in France.

Is Bangladesh a poor country?

Bangladesh country profile. Bangladesh is one of the world's most densely-populated countries, with its people crammed into a delta of rivers that empty into the Bay of Bengal. Poverty is widespread, but Bangladesh has in recent years reduced population growth and improved health and education.
